
你知道吗?在这个数字化时代,软件系统安全测试协议可是个至关重要的话题。想象你每天使用的各种APP、网站,背后都有这么一套严谨的测试流程,确保它们能安全可靠地运行。今天,就让我带你深入了解一下这个神秘的领域吧!

首先,得弄清楚什么是软件系统安全测试协议。简单来说,它就是一套规范,用于指导如何对软件系统进行安全测试。这就像是一场精心编排的舞蹈,每个步骤都至关重要,以确保舞者(也就是软件系统)在舞台上(也就是互联网世界)优雅地展现自己。

你知道吗,安全测试协议的重要性堪比武林秘籍。为什么这么说呢?因为只有通过严格的测试,才能确保软件系统在面临各种攻击时,能够坚如磐石。否则,一旦系统被攻破,后果不堪设想,轻则数据泄露,重则可能导致整个网络瘫痪。

接下来,让我们来了解一下安全测试协议的流程。一般来说,它包括以下几个步骤:
1. 需求分析:首先,要明确测试的目标和范围,比如要测试哪些功能,哪些安全漏洞需要关注等。
2. 测试计划:根据需求分析,制定详细的测试计划,包括测试方法、测试用例、测试环境等。
3. 测试执行:按照测试计划,执行各种测试用例,观察系统是否出现安全漏洞。
4. 缺陷修复:在测试过程中,一旦发现安全漏洞,要及时修复,并重新进行测试。
5. 测试报告:整理测试结果,形成测试报告,为后续的改进提供依据。
在软件系统安全测试领域,有许多著名的测试协议,比如:
1. OWASP Top 10:这是一个全球范围内广泛认可的网络安全风险列表,涵盖了最常见的10种安全漏洞。
2. PCI DSS:支付卡行业数据安全标准,旨在确保信用卡数据的安全。
3. ISO 27001:国际信息安全管理体系标准,旨在帮助组织建立和维护信息安全管理体系。
4. NIST SP 800-53:美国国家标准与技术研究院发布的信息安全控制框架,适用于各种类型的组织。
安全测试协议的应用范围非常广泛,几乎涵盖了所有类型的软件系统。无论是企业级应用、移动应用,还是物联网设备,都需要进行安全测试。以下是一些典型的应用场景:
1. 金融行业:银行、证券、保险等金融机构,对信息安全的要求极高,安全测试协议在这里发挥着至关重要的作用。
2. 电子商务:电商平台需要确保用户数据的安全,防止恶意攻击。
3. 政府机构:政府部门对信息安全的要求同样严格,安全测试协议在这里同样不可或缺。
4. 医疗行业:医疗数据涉及个人隐私,安全测试协议在这里有助于保护患者信息安全。
软件系统安全测试协议是确保网络安全的重要保障。在这个数字化时代,了解并掌握这些知识,对于我们每个人来说都至关重要。让我们一起努力,为构建一个更加安全的网络环境贡献自己的力量吧!